Scala

scala jdk

scala jdk
  1. Z czego JDK korzysta Scala?
  2. Czy Scala działa na JVM?
  3. Jak uzyskać zestaw SDK Scala?
  4. Jak zainstalować Scala w systemie Windows 10?
  5. Czy Scala nie żyje?
  6. Jakie firmy używają Scala?
  7. Jest to frontend lub backend Scali?
  8. Czy Scala może działać bez JVM?
  9. Czy Scala jest warta nauki 2020?
  10. Czy Scala jest trudna do nauczenia?
  11. Czy Scala jest lepsza niż Java?
  12. Jak uruchomić kod Scala?

Z czego JDK korzysta Scala?

Generalnie zalecamy JDK 8 lub 11 do kompilowania kodu Scala. Ponieważ maszyna JVM jest zwykle kompatybilna wstecz, zwykle bezpiecznie jest używać nowszej maszyny JVM do uruchamiania kodu, zwłaszcza jeśli nie używasz funkcji JVM oznaczonych jako „eksperymentalne” lub „niebezpieczne”.

Czy Scala działa na JVM?

Kod źródłowy Scala można skompilować do kodu bajtowego Java i uruchomić na wirtualnej maszynie Java (JVM).

Jak uzyskać zestaw SDK Scala?

Tworzenie projektu

  1. Otwórz IntelliJ i kliknij Plik => Nowy => Projekt.
  2. W lewym panelu wybierz Scala. ...
  3. Nazwij projekt HelloWorld.
  4. Zakładając, że po raz pierwszy tworzysz projekt Scala za pomocą IntelliJ, musisz zainstalować pakiet SDK Scala. ...
  5. Wybierz najwyższy numer wersji (np.sol. 2.13.

Jak zainstalować Scala w systemie Windows 10?

Pobierz i zainstaluj Scala w systemie Windows

Sprawdź instalację pakietu JDK na komputerze z systemem Windows, wpisując następujące polecenia w wierszu poleceń. Pobierz pliki binarne Scala z https: // www.scala-lang.org / download /. Plik instalatora Scala zostanie pobrany z . rozszerzenie msi.

Czy Scala nie żyje?

Chociaż ilość szumu wokół języka Scala zdecydowanie opadła z biegiem lat, wydaje się, że jego użycie rośnie w stałym tempie, a doświadczenie w używaniu języka szybko się poprawia.

Jakie firmy używają Scala?

Zanim przejdziemy krok po kroku, rzućmy okiem na ogólną listę najlepszych firm korzystających ze Scali:

Jest to frontend lub backend Scali?

js to implementacja Scali autorstwa Sébastiena Doeraene, która kompiluje kod Scala do JavaScript, a nie kodu bajtowego JVM. Zachowuje pełną dwukierunkową interoperacyjność między kodem Scala i JavaScript i umożliwia tworzenie aplikacji internetowych typu front-end w Scali przy użyciu bibliotek i frameworków JavaScript.

Czy Scala może działać bez JVM?

Czy mogę uruchomić mój program Scala bez JVM, używając natywnej wersji Scala? Tak, celem Scala Native jest wsparcie kompilacji programów Scala bez jakiejkolwiek maszyny wirtualnej. ... Kod jest nadal ostatecznie kompilowany do kodu natywnego, jedyną różnicą jest to, że dzieje się to później, podczas działania aplikacji.

Czy Scala jest warta nauki 2020?

Jeśli korzystasz z JVM, Scala jest doskonałym wyborem dla nowych systemów. Zapewnia dostęp do całego starego kodu. W AWS, lambda zwraca wiele abstrakcji usług internetowych. Czas uruchamiania JVM może być dużym kosztem w przypadku lambda.

Czy Scala jest trudna do nauczenia?

Wbrew popularnym opiniom w Internecie Scala nie jest trudnym językiem do wypróbowania. Dzieje się tak głównie ze względu na jego bezproblemową kompatybilność z Javą i rodzaj dwoistej natury (programowanie funkcjonalne vs programowanie obiektowe). Możesz ubrudzić sobie ręce, zaczynając pisać kod podobny do Java w Scali.

Czy Scala jest lepsza niż Java?

Java jest świetna ze względu na swoją wszechstronność, siłę i zdolność do obsługi złożonych zadań. ... Scala jest świetna i często okazuje się lepsza niż Java tylko dlatego, że rozwiązuje wiele problemów, które są wspólne dla Javy. Z drugiej strony Scala jest równie solidna jak Java i ma doskonałą pojemność.

Jak uruchomić kod Scala?

Innym sposobem wykonania kodu Scala jest wpisanie go do pliku tekstowego i zapisanie z nazwą kończącą się na „. scala ”. Następnie możemy wykonać ten kod, wpisując „scala nazwa pliku”. Na przykład możemy utworzyć plik o nazwie hello.

Jak zainstalować i używać FFmpeg na Ubuntu 20.04
Jak zainstalować i używać FFmpeg na Ubuntu 20.04 Wymagania. Musisz mieć dostęp do powłoki z dostępem do konta uprzywilejowanego sudo na swoim Ubuntu 2...
Jak zainstalować FFmpeg na Debianie 9 (Stretch)
Poniższe kroki opisują, jak zainstalować FFmpeg na Debianie 9 Zacznij od zaktualizowania listy pakietów sudo apt update. Zainstaluj pakiet FFmpeg, uru...
Jak zainstalować moduł Apache mod_wsgi na Ubuntu 16.04 (Xenial)
Jak zainstalować moduł Apache mod_wsgi na Ubuntu 16.04 (Xenial) Krok 1 - Warunki wstępne. Zaloguj się do Ubuntu 16.04 konsoli serwera za pośrednictwem...